This page lists factory torque specifications for rear suspension on the 1990 Volkswagen Golf Mk2. It covers 5 components across 14 engine variants (KR, PL, 9A, HZ, NZ, HK, 1V, 1H, PG, PF, RV, 1P, RP, 1Y), with 6 distinct torque values sourced from the VW ELSA factory workshop manual. All values are given in Newton metres (Nm) with imperial equivalents where applicable.

Rear Suspension

  • Coil spring retainer to rear shock absorber nut
    • 15 Nm (11 ft·lb) All 14 engines
    • 70 Nm (52 ft·lb) All 14 engines
  • Rear axle beam pivot bolt bolt and self-locking nut
    • 60 Nm (44 ft·lb) All 14 engines
  • Rear axle mounting bracket to body collar bolt
    • 85 Nm (63 ft·lb) All 14 engines
  • Rear brake backing plate and stub axle to axle beam
    • 60 Nm (44 ft·lb) All 14 engines
  • Rear hub nut — Syncro driven rear axle
    • 230 Nm 1H
